It's a nightmare to discover that your key fob has died, and you are unable to unlock your vehicle. It's easy to change the battery yourself and save money at the dealer.

The first step is to press the auxiliary key button located on the back of the key fob. This will remove the key auxiliary and reveal slots on both sides of the case. Place the flathead in one of these slots and then gently pry the two halves apart. When the battery is completely exposed, remove it and put it away somewhere safe from being lost.

Make sure you have an extra battery in place before you start. You can find these in any store that sells batteries or at an Mazda dealer near Winter Garden. Choosing the right battery will ensure that your key fob operates properly.

Next, put the new battery in the correct place and replace the cap of the battery. Be careful not to scratch the small rubber ring that the battery rests on. Press the two halves together until you hear a click.
